Overview

Mocha's in Silver Springs has accumulated 180 violations across 32 inspections since 2016, averaging 5.6 per visit. The facility was shut down four times for rodent activity. State records show five disciplinary actions totaling $2,950 in fines, with the largest single penalty reaching $800. The most frequently cited violations involve employee health policy, single-use items, and proper hand and arm washing.

Most recent closure: March 9, 2016 for rodent activity.

Summary generated from Florida DBPR public inspection records.
